Strong and unusual effect of Zn doping on the magnetoresistance of Y1-xCaxBa2Cu3O7-d Thin Films
The role of substantial in-plane disorder (Zn and Ca) on the charge transport and ac susceptibility of Y1-xCaxBa2Cu3O7-d was investigated over a wide range of planar hole concentration p. Resistivity for a number of overdoped to underdoped samples showed clear downturns at a characteristic temperature similar to that found at T* in Zn-free underdoped samples because of the presence of the pseudogap. AC susceptibility of thise heavily disordered samples showed the superfluid density to be extremely low.
